This year the 31st annual PMC will be held starting on Saturday, August 7th through Sunday, August 8th. During the PMC weekend, in addition to the 5500 riders there will be over 2600 volunteers who donate their time, and 200 corporations who provide in-kind donations of products or services. Many riders (including myself) ride in honor of family members or friends who have fought this disease. It is a truly inspiring ride. While there are today many athletic fundraising events, the PMC is arguably the most successful in terms of the money raised and the percentage of funds it contributes directly to charity. In 2009, 100 percent of all funds raised by PMC riders went directly to the Jimmy Fund. Not one cent of each dollar raised through riders' sweat and determination was used for administrative and organizational expenses.
